Output 8fb2cde1e29561ca59cc7ea9300ea02c4a7ff42a32c8f0c7a73e5ce575bc0e99:14

value
328290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be79c54b58ac541c7e42e815268eb102e36a95 OP_EQUAL
address
3CyKDcvj1sWrtzR82PBgi3xDZaCp28iCwD
transaction
8fb2cde1e29561ca59cc7ea9300ea02c4a7ff42a32c8f0c7a73e5ce575bc0e99
confirmations
260425
spent
true